Майже через 22 роки після виходу операційної системи Windows XP, схоже, цього тижня нарешті вдалося розшифрувати алгоритм коду активації. Це означає, що в майбутньому можна буде активувати будь-яку копію XP без злому і без модифікації системного коду – навіть якщо Microsoft вимкне сервери.
Windows XP була першою системою Microsoft, яка вимагала для активації не лише введення ключа продукту, але й під’єднання до Інтернету або телефону, без якого система могла використовуватися з повною функціональністю лише протягом обмеженого періоду часу. Поточна розробка ефективно знімає це обмеження і робить активацію XP можливою навіть у повністю офлайновому середовищі і за допомогою практично будь-якого ключа, який сам собою є дійсним.
Завдяки розшифровці системи кодів активації тепер можна буде генерувати коди відповіді по телефону, необхідні для активації Windows XP в автономному режимі, без участі Microsoft.
Активація Windows – це двоетапний процес, під час якого система надсилає ключ продукту, введений користувачем, згенерований код і деяку інформацію про апаратне забезпечення до систем Microsoft (через Інтернет або автовідповідач по телефону). Якщо код визнано дійсним, а комп’ютер і користувач мають право на використання ключа, ключ активації надсилається назад до XP, що знімає будь-які обмеження на активацію.
Але тепер нарешті розшифровано алгоритм, за яким сервери Microsoft генерують ключ активації на основі переданого коду. Це означає, що в майбутньому можна буде згенерувати ключ перевірки для будь-якого телефонного коду, наданого повністю неушкодженою і справжньою, не зламаною Windows XP без участі Microsoft – і таким чином активувати XP без обмежень, навіть на комп’ютерах, що не мають підключення до Інтернету.
Для більшості користувачів ця розробка не має жодного значення, оскільки більшість із них не хотіли б використовувати Windows XP в жодному разі, адже вона вважається застарілим програмним забезпеченням, а також украй небезпечна для використання на комп’ютері з під’єднанням до Інтернету через безліч вразливостей, що містяться в ній. Водночас розшифровка алгоритму гарантує, що система може бути встановлена і активована до самої вічності – або до тих пір, поки існує комп’ютер чи емуляція, здатна її запустити, таким чином, зберігаючи її функціональність і працездатність для майбутніх поколінь.
Джерело: origo.hu